Understanding the Types of Window Panes
Before diving into the repair procedure, it's necessary to understand the various kinds of window panes. Each type has its special attributes and repair needs.
| Type of Window Pane | Description | Common Issues |
|---|---|---|
| Single Pane | A single sheet of glass. | Chips, cracks, or shattering. |
| Double Pane | Two sheets of glass with an air space for insulation. | Seal failure, wetness in between panes. |
| Triple Pane | 3 sheets of glass with 2 air spaces. | Similar to double pane but more complex. |
| Tempered Glass | Heat-treated for strength. | May shatter into small pieces. |
| Laminated Glass | Two sheets of glass bonded together. | Scratches and chips, less likely to shatter. |
Comprehending these differences is important when approaching repairs, as the materials and methods can differ significantly.

Step-by-Step Window Pane Repair Process
Now that you are geared up with the necessary tools and materials, here's a step-by-step guide to repairing a window pane.
Action 1: Assess the Damage
- Determine if the pane is cracked, chipped, or completely shattered.
- If it is a single pane, you will likely need to replace it totally. For double and triple panes, consider whether the seal is broken or if the glass itself is damaged.
Step 2: Remove the Old Glass
- If the glass is shattered, wear security goggles and gloves for protection.
- Use an energy knife to cut through any old glazing putty surrounding the glass.
- Carefully get rid of any glazing points using a screwdriver or pliers.
Action 3: Measure and Cut Replacement Glass
- Measure the opening left by the old pane, and add 1/8 inch to both the height and width for an appropriate fit.
- Use the utility knife to cut your replacement glass to the suitable size. If cutting glass seems overwhelming, consider having it pre-cut at a local hardware shop.
Step 4: Install the New Glass
- Place the new glass into the frame.
- Insert the glazing points at routine periods to hold the glass strongly in location. Normally, three to 4 points will be enough for a basic pane.
- Use a thin bead of glazing putty around the edges of the glass, smoothing it with your finger for a clean finish.
Step 5: Allow the Putty to Cure
- Offer the glazing putty sufficient time to cure. This might take numerous days, depending on the item used. Inspect the maker's directions for specific treating times.
Step 6: Final Touches
- When treated, use a coat of paint or sealant to match the rest of the window frame, if required.

F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TION: Window Pane Repair
1. Can I repair a Double Glazing Repairs-pane window myself?
Yes, however the procedure is more complicated than a single pane. If the seal has failed, replacing it normally needs professional support.

2. How long does the glazing putty take to treat?
Treating times vary by item, but normally, it can take anywhere from a few days to a few weeks.

3. Is it much better to repair or change a broken window?
It depends on the level of the damage. Small cracks can be repaired, however if the glass is shattered or the frame is compromised, replacement may be essential.
4. What should I do if I have a safety worry about a broken window?
Cover the broken area with plastic sheeting or cardboard up until repairs can be completed. If the window postures immediate danger, consider calling a professional for emergency repairs.
5. Can I utilize regular glass for a window replacement?
Standard glass can be utilized for repairs, however it's suggested to utilize tempered or laminated glass in locations where safety is an issue.
